Youngstown Vs. Ohio Public Health Employment
| Youngstown | 1,110 |
| Ohio | 20,960 |
Exactly 1,110 of the 20,960 public health professionals employed in Ohio, work in Youngstown. Between 2006 and 2010, the number of public health professionals in Youngstown has grown by 48%. As the number of public health professionals in Youngstown has increased, overall employment in Youngstown has also increased.

Salaries for public health professionals in Youngstown have decreased. Youngstown public health professionals made $48,977 per year, on average, in 2010. The average salary for public health professionals in Youngstown was $49,163 per year, four years earlier in 2006. The decline in the salary of public health professionals in Youngstown is slower than the salary trend for all careers in the city.

Public health professionals in Youngstown earn a median salary of $48,610 per year. The 10% of public health professionals in the lowest pay bracket earn less than $30,873 per year, while those in the highest pay bracket earn approximately 126% higher salaries.
